What type of fire extinguisher should a landlord have for tenants? In an average sized rental property it is advisable for a landlord to provide the tenant with a fire blanket for the kitchen and a small portable fire extinguisher such as a 2ltr foam or 3ltr water with additive to cover the rest of the property. Is a landlord required to provide a fire extinguisher?
Your landlord is required to provide a fire extinguisher in either the common areas of your apartment complex or in your apartment unit. In addition, an apartment, house or condominium must contain a smoke detector. The law is enforced by local building and fire code officials.
